Governor Alex Otti, has signed “Dig Once Policy” to signal his administration’s bold move to prepare the state for technological advancement.
He said the policy would also “bring about drastic reduction in the needles losses arising from the destruction of underground cables and other infrastructure” in the course of projects construction and subsequent disruption in internet services. “Our target is the young people who are actively migrating to the digital space in pursuit of new opportunities. This policy will give them wings to fly as high-speed internet services become commonplace in all parts of the State.
